<h1>Identity Insights Overview: Identity Fraud Prevention and Phone Number Validation</h1>
Vonage Identity Insights API empowers developers and SaaS builders with real-time telecom data through a single, streamlined API for phone number validation and identity verification. Retrieve trusted attributes related to a phone number subscriber, device, and network to validate phone numbers, prevent identity fraud, and optimize communications. No need for multiple vendors. Build your own phone validator tool with plug-and-play setup for KYC and fraud detection.
<h1>KYC and Phone Validator Key Use Cases: Prevent Identity Fraud and Mitigate Risk of Deepfake Account Creation</h1>
<li>
Stop account takeovers and prevent identity fraud using SIM swap detection, line type verification, and carrier-backed KYC data.
<li>
Trigger step-up authentication only when risk is detected, reducing user friction while enhancing security with a phone number validator tool and scam detection.
<h1>KYC Automation and Onboarding With Phone Validation</h1>
<li>Match user-submitted data, including name, address, and date of birth, against mobile operator records in real time for KYC and age verification.
<li>Eliminate manual document uploads, accelerate conversion, and validate cell phone numbers to reduce regulatory risk and fight identity spoofing.
<h1>Phone Number Intelligence With Build-Your-Own Phone Number Validator</h1>
<li>Determine if a number is active, reachable, and appropriate using a validator phone system.
<li>Identify number type (mobile, VoIP, premium), original and current carrier, and line status. These insights reduce bounce rates, marketing waste, and delivery errors through contact number validation and caller identification.
<h1>Smarter Outreach With KYC and Phone Validation</h1>
<li>Know where and how to reach users with confidence using powerful phone validation capabilities.
<li>Use network intelligence to optimize SMS, voice, or omnichannel strategies.
Align outreach with user time zones and preferences for better engagement and lower costs.
<h1>Data Enrichment for KYC Workflows and Fraud Detection</h1>
<li>Enrich CRM and risk systems with fresh telecom signals.
<li>Use SIM swap and subscriber match data to improve segmentation, scoring models, and fraud detection.
<h1>Product Features of Vonage Identity Insights API for KYC and Identity Verification</h1>
<li>Real-time SIM swap detection for scam detection
<li>Number format validation by country, time zone, assignability
Carrier and line type detection for contact number validation
<li>Subscriber match (name, address, date of birth) for KYC
<li>Caller identification (U.S. only)
<li>Lightweight, secure API integration
<li>Usage-based pricing with no upfront fees
